Grape seed extract (GSE) is a common dietary supplement that is known to be rich in the flavan-3-ols, commonly known as catechins. However, the bioavailability and the biological effects of the grape seed extract flavonoids are poorly understood. WebMay 21, 2024 · The grape seed extract (GSE) and its main active polyphenol, resveratrol (RES), have shown considerable antioxidant activities, besides possessed protective and therapeutic effects against various skin complications. ... The oral bioavailability of RES is very poor (less than 1%) with a short initial half-life (8–14 min) .
